China News Agency, Brussels, May 4 (Reporter De Yongjian) As a representative of the Chinese government, Zhang Ming, head of the Chinese mission to the EU, attended the video conference of the International Pledge Conference on the New Coronary Pneumonia Epidemic on the 4th and delivered a speech.

  Zhang Ming pointed out that China is a responsible member of the international community. Although its own epidemic prevention tasks are still arduous, it still tries its best to provide assistance to countries in need within its ability. The Chinese government has set up special funds for anti-epidemic cooperation, and has provided much-needed anti-epidemic material assistance to more than 150 countries and international organizations. Local governments, charities, people's organizations, and business circles have also actively participated. In order to respond to the epidemic, China has increased its investment in scientific research, unreservedly shared prevention and control experience and diagnosis and treatment plans with the international community, opened an online knowledge center for epidemic prevention and control opened to all countries, and held more than 120 meetings with more than 160 countries and international organizations Video exchange conference, sending 19 medical expert groups to 17 countries. China also actively supports countries in carrying out commercial procurement of materials in China.

  In order to support and respond to WHO's initiative and promote the development of new coronary pneumonia diagnosis and treatment and vaccine development, the EU and relevant countries jointly initiated this pledging conference. On 4th, there were 42 national leaders and senior government representatives as well as the UN Secretary-General Organize the Director General to attend the meeting. (Finish)
